Mobility Scooter Benefits and Drawbacks
Mobility scooters assist people with limited mobility to get around their neighborhoods and homes. The scooters have seats over three, four or more wheels. They have flat bottoms for feet and handlebars to control the steering.

Reduced Physical Strain
Mobility scooters can be found on many streets. They offer freedom and a better quality of life for those with limited mobility. It is simple to imagine how these vehicles could be beneficial, but it is important to consider the disadvantages.
One of the major benefits of mobility scooters is that they aid in reducing the physical strain that is frequently caused by walking, especially over long distances or on uneven surfaces. This can be particularly beneficial for those who struggle with arthritis, as it can prevent discomfort and inflammation caused by overexertion.
Mobility scooters are also more comfortable and stable than walking. This makes them an ideal choice for those with balance issues or who are more prone to fall. Most scooters have safety features that prevent injuries in the case of an accident.
Mobility scooters depend on batteries to power the device and provide transportation. Therefore, it is crucial to maintain the battery in a proper manner, following the manufacturer's guidelines regarding charging and charging cycles. This can extend the battery's life and avoid breakdowns.
Another issue with mobility scooters is that they may be difficult to transport. Some models will require disassembling or folded in order to fit in the trunk of a vehicle. Some are large and heavy and require an elevator or ramp for loading into a vehicle.

The flexibility of mobility scooters allows them to be used for a wide range of different tasks including shopping to day outings with friends. In fact, studies have discovered that people who use scooters typically use their devices three to five times a week, with most trips taking place in local places (Barton et al. 2014). Although some scooters are unable to accessing buildings due to their size and turning radius however this problem is often alleviated by an elevator or lift, which are usually provided in newer public facilities.

Another advantage of mobility scooters is that they are capable of traversing a wider variety of terrain than wheelchairs, which makes them more suitable for outdoor activities. For example, some scooters feature a rugged suspension system and larger wheels that allow them to navigate grassy paths or uneven sidewalks without difficulty. This flexibility can make it easier for users to go on walking tours of their favourite cities or to take the scenic drive through the countryside, regardless of their physical limitations.

There are many different types of mobility devices available on the market. They can be tailored to meet a wide range of needs. If you're interested in acquiring one, it is important to consult with your physician about the model that is best for you. It is also essential to speak with your insurance company to determine if you are able to get help with the cost of the device. In the US mobility scooters is considered to be durable medical equipment and is covered under Medicare Part B with a prescription from your physician.
